
ST. GEORGE — Building of the New York Wheel and Empire Outlets will start in Staten Island next month, developers said.
The two large projects will have a joint invite-only groundbreaking ceremony on March 10, a spokesman for the New York Wheel said.
The 625-foot Ferris wheel is expected to be the world's largest when it's completed, which is scheduled to be in 2017.
It will have four bar cars and a 20-seat restaurant so riders can eat and drink as they take in the view. The site will also include a "4-D Theater Experience" that simulates an underground subway ride from Staten Island to Manhattan, a route that doesn't currently exist.
